A rectangular prism has dimensions h = 2 ft, w = 7 ft, and l = 4 ft. The prism is cut into two separate rectangular prisms by a plane parallel to one of the faces. What is the maximum increase in the surface area between the original prism and the two separate prisms?
A. 8 ft
B. 14 ft
C. 16 ft
D. 28 ft
E. 56 ft
